More choices for electronically controlling small engines

Two new devices designed to reduce system complexity and shorten time to market for one- and two-cylinder small engines are now available. The one-cylinder (MC33813) and two-cylinder (MC33814) electronic control semiconductors are for transportation, industrial and consumer applications. The ICs compliment and extend Freescale’s motorcycle engine control unit (ECU) reference platform, which contains Freescale’s MC9S12 MCU

##IMAGE_1_R##Freescale’s product portfolio includes a wide range of 16- and 32-bit MCUs with companion analog and mixed signal ICs (U-Chip) that offer high-quality, cost-effective solutions for the requirements of evolving automotive quality standards, motorcycle and small engine control.

Future generation will be based on system in chip package (SiP) to match with integration and cost effectiveness needs of this application.

Target Applications:
Scooter
Motorcycle Engine Control Unit (ECU)
Three-wheeler
Lawn equipment
Small Engine
Gasoline driven electric generators
Marine engines and personal watercraft
